Ako vytvoriť vlastnú stránku 404 vo WordPress

Nie je pochýb o tom, že väčšina používateľov internetu je príliš známa Stránka 404 sa nenašla chybná správa. Pravdepodobne ste boli bombardovaní touto nepríjemnou správou aspoň raz za tento mesiac, keď ste klikli na nefunkčný odkaz.


Chyba 404 je štandardná odpoveď HTTP na požiadavku webovej stránky, ktorú server nedokázal splniť z rôznych dôvodov. V predvolenom nastavení sa chybové hlásenie zobrazuje ako obyčajný text na bielom pozadí. Ak túto nenávistnú správu nenávidíte, nechceli by ste vystaviť návštevníkov svojich webových stránok, aby ju videli. Tak prečo to neznepokojuje prostredníctvom vlastnej správy?

V tomto návode vás prevediem krokmi vytvorenia vlastného Stránka nenájdená správu, aby boli návštevníci vašich webových stránok menej podráždení, keď narazia na prázdne miesto. Najprv však lepšie porozumieme tomu, prečo by ste pri pokuse o prístup na webovú stránku mohli naraziť na prázdne miesto.

Contents

Ako a prečo Stránka 404 sa nenašla Vyskytujú sa chyby

Keď kliknete na odkaz a zobrazí sa chyba 404, znamená to, že vaša požiadavka na stránku bola úspešná, ale server nenašiel konkrétnu stránku, na ktorú ste sa pokúsili získať prístup. Existuje veľa príčin.

Napríklad, ak bola webová stránka, na ktorú sa odkaz pripájal, odstránená, zobrazí sa chyba 404. Typický scenár, ktorý k tomu vedie, je, keď sa odstráni zastaraná stránka, ktorá obsahovala populárny obsah, napriek tomu, že na ňu bolo veľa odkazov z iných webových stránok. Veľkým vinníkom sú veľké spravodajské weby, ak správcovia webových stránok nepodnikajú preventívne kroky, aby zabránili chýbajúcim odkazom na stránku.

Chyba 404 stránky sa môže vyskytnúť aj v prípade, že požadovaná stránka bola premiestnená do nového názvu domény. Ak je problém so serverom (server je nefunkčný alebo je z nejakého dôvodu neprístupný), môže sa zobraziť chyba DNS. Brány firewall, filtre obsahu a ďalšie formy blokovania obsahu môžu tiež spôsobiť nefunkčné odkazy.

Zrátané a podčiarknuté, nefunkčné odkazy sú na webe bežné. Je na majiteľoch alebo správcoch webových stránok, aby túto skúsenosť zrozumiteľnejšie pre používateľov. Pamätajte, že používatelia internetu sú pri vyhľadávaní informácií na webových stránkach zvyčajne netrpezliví. Používateľ nebude strácať čas hľadaním inej webovej stránky, aby získal to, čo chce, ak všetko, čo na vás našlo, bolo obyčajné a dráždilo chybu 404..

Chybové hlásenie priateľské k používateľovi

Ako som už uviedol, väčšina webových serverov je nastavená na vrátenie základnej stránky 404 Error, ktorá zobrazuje ospravedlnenie krátky popis, prečo ste sa k požadovanej stránke nedostali. V niektorých prípadoch vám môže byť tiež ponúknutý odkaz na e-mail správcu webu (ak potrebujete technickú podporu) alebo odkaz na vyhľadávací nástroj, aby ste mohli pokračovať vo vyhľadávaní..

Aj keď je táto predvolená chybová správa zdvorilá, pre väčšinu návštevníkov webových stránok je celkom jasná a zvyčajne vypnutá. Preto seriózni webmasteri prispôsobujú túto správu tak, aby sa návštevníkom, ktorí zasiahli medzery, mohla zobraziť stránka príjemnejšia (a menej dráždivá)..

Všetky predvolené témy, ktoré sa dodávajú s programom WordPress, majú pomenovanú základnú šablónu stránky Chyba 404 404.php. Táto predvolená šablóna samozrejme funguje perfektne, je však pravdepodobné, že nehovorí, čo chcete svojim návštevníkom povedať. Našťastie je prispôsobenie správy v šablóne hračkou. Jednoducho otvorte šablónu stránky v editore kódu a zmeňte text správy na svoj vlastný. Zmeny uložte po.

Štruktúra predvolenej šablóny chybovej stránky dodávanej s Dvadsať trinásť Téma pozostáva zo značiek na zobrazenie hlavičky, päty a vyhľadávacieho panela. Takto to vyzerá v akcii (do panela s adresou prehliadača napíšte falošnú adresu stránky):

Dvadsať trinásť

Ak preskúmate kód svojej šablóny stránky 404, všimnete si nadpis stránky Nenájdené v rámci

nadpis značky spolu s a _e funkcia, ktorá skutočne zobrazuje výsledok na stránke. To je to, čo budete chcieť najprv upraviť, keď prispôsobíte svoju stránku 404. Potom môžete pokračovať a pridať do prehliadača text vhodnejší pre používateľa

a

značky pod ním. Upozorňujeme, že môžete alebo nemusíte zmeniť Nenájdené nadpis, ale vo všeobecnosti je dobré uviesť vlastný nadpis, ktorý nedráždi vašich návštevníkov, spolu s vlastným textom v odsekoch.

Môžete si tiež všimnúť, že nadpis sa objavuje vo vnútri obrovského 404 číslo na stránke. Keď urobíte kontrolu svojej chybovej stránky pomocou Firebug, uvidíte, že je obrovská 404 je vložený pseudoprvkom (.error404 .page-title: before). Takže otvorte 404.php šablónu a nahradiť predvolený text v

,

, a

Značky toho, čo chcete svojim návštevníkom povedať. Vyššie uvedený pseudoprvok tiež upravte podľa svojich predstáv alebo ho odstráňte (komentujte to v šablóne so štýlmi). Zmenil som to na toto:

Dvadsať trinásť prispôsobených 404 stránok

Aj keď tu môžete povedať čokoľvek, čo chcete, priamo svojim návštevníkom, vždy je dobré, aby to bolo krátke a milé. Pokúste sa v prvom rade povedať alebo nasmerovať návštevníka na to, čo mohol hľadať. A to je takmer všetko, čo musíte urobiť, aby bola vaša stránka 404 užívateľsky príjemnejšia. Skontrolujte stránku a potom podľa potreby zmeňte štýly.

V závislosti od témy WordPress, ktorú používate, vývojár môže zahrnúť aj vlastnú podporu 404 stránok. V našej téme Total WordPress sme zabudovali možnosť vlastnej témy 404, ktorá uľahčuje pridanie vlastného presmerovania 404 alebo vlastného nadpisu a obsahu stránky priamo z ovládacieho panela WordPress..

Snímka obrazovky vlastného editora 404 stránok celkom

Celkový príklad vlastnej stránky WordPRess 404 strán

.htaccess Súbor je miesto, kde sa stane kúzlo

Po prispôsobení vášho 404.php zostane všetko, čo WordPress zobrazí, keď je to vhodné – keď nemôže nájsť konkrétnu stránku. Toto je predvolený proces. Existujú však situácie, keď sa webový server môže stretnúť s problémami skôr, ako si ich bude vedomý WordPress, čo znamená, že návštevníci nemusia mať prístup k niektorým stránkam. V takom prípade musíte zaistiť, aby ich webový server mohol presmerovať na svoju stránku 404.php, a to je miesto, kde .htcaccess súbor prichádza.

.htcaccess súbor sa nachádza v koreňovom priečinku inštalácie WordPress. V prípade WordPress sa vygeneruje automaticky, keď zmeníte štruktúru permalinku z predvoleného nastavenia. Všetko, čo musíte urobiť, aby server zistil, že vaša vlastná stránka 404 je do súboru pridať jediný riadok:

ErrorDocument 404 /index.php?error=404

Ako vidíte, táto webová adresa sa začína v koreňovom adresári (/), čo znamená, že na použitie tohto formátu webovej adresy musí byť vaša inštalácia WordPress v koreňovom adresári servera. V opačnom prípade, ak je WordPress nainštalovaný v podadresári, cesta presmerovania by mala byť:

ErrorDocument 404 /yourfolder/index.php?error=404

Týmto spôsobom, aj keď zmeníte tému, index.php vždy vyvolá správny súbor 404 pre vašu novú tému.

Zabalenie

Čítaním tohto stručného návodu si teraz môžete vytvoriť vlastnú stránku 404 doplnenú o správu priateľskú pre používateľa. Môžete tiež nakonfigurovať .htcaccess súbor, aby ste zaistili, že návštevníci vašich webových stránok budú serverom vždy presmerovaní na správnu stránku 404 v situáciách, keď WordPress nie je schopný alebo keď zmeníte motívy.

Ak chcete prilákať verných návštevníkov, ktorí sa vždy vrátia na váš web, je dôležité prispôsobiť si stránku 404 s menej dráždivou správou. Dobrým nápadom je samozrejme aj to, koľkokrát návštevník dokonca pristane na stránke 404.

Máte nejaké skvelé nápady pre vlastnú správu 404? Čo momentálne používate na svojej stránke 404? Rád by som počul vaše nápady v komentároch nižšie!

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me
    Like this post? Please share to your friends:
    Adblock
    detector
    map